Abstract

PURPOSE:To easily obtain a pressure-sensitive adhesive tape whose pressure- sensitive adhesive layer contains uniformly dispersed bubbles by feeding a pressure-sensitive adhesive solution to a coater by means of a gear pump with a specified end clearance, applying the solution to a substrate and drying the applied film by heating. CONSTITUTION:A pressure-sensitive solution held in a reservoir is fed to a coater by means of a gear pump having an outer rotor 1 and an inner rotor 2 and having an end clearance set at 0.3-0.8mm. When the pump starts running, the rotors 1 and 2 are rotated by a drive shaft 3, suck the pressure-sensitive adhesive solution through the inlet and force through the discharge exit 6. During this operation, part of the outside air is sucked through the gap between the rotor shaft 4 and the casing 5 and the end clearance 8 into the inlet side and formed into bubbles. These bubbles are further finely divided through the bite between the rotors 1 and 2. The pressure-sensitive adhesive solution containing the formed fine bubbles is applied to a substrate with a coater and dried by heating to produce a pressure-sensitive adhesive tape.

2. Description of the Related Art Adhesive strength of an adhesive tape changes depending on the surface condition of the adherend. In particular, if the surface is a rough surface having fine irregularities, the adhesive force is greatly reduced. For example,
FIG. 3 is a cross-sectional view showing a state in which a general pressure-sensitive adhesive tape is adhered to an adherend having irregularities on its surface. 9 is a base material, 10 is an adhesive layer, and 11 is an adherend. However, as can be seen, if the surface of the adherend 11 has irregularities, a space 12 is created between the adherend layer 10 and the adhesive layer 10, and the contact area between the pressure-sensitive adhesive layer 10 and the adherend 11 decreases, resulting in adhesion. The power is reduced.

As a countermeasure, it is necessary to give the substrate a cushioning property or disperse air bubbles in the adhesive layer to give elasticity so that the adhesive layer fits well to the irregularities and rough surfaces of the adherend. It is well known (Patent Office publication "Collection of Well-Known Conventional Techniques (Adhesion)", page 216, June 1, 1984.
Issued on the 5th).

FIG. 4 shows a state in which an adhesive tape having air bubbles dispersed in an adhesive layer is attached to an adherend. 13 is a base material, 14
Is an adhesive layer, 15 is an adherend having an uneven surface, and 16 is air bubbles dispersed in the adhesive layer 14. As shown in this figure, when the pressure-sensitive adhesive tape is attached to the adherend 15, the pressure causes the pressure-sensitive adhesive layer 14 containing the bubbles 16 to deform and enter the irregularities of the adherend 15, resulting in less voids therebetween. Therefore, the adhesive strength does not decrease.

As a method for dispersing air bubbles in the adhesive layer, (1) a pressure-sensitive adhesive is mixed with a foaming agent in advance, or a foaming gas is dissolved, and the pressure-sensitive adhesive is applied or heated. Allow to foam when dry. (2) A gas is blown into the pressure-sensitive adhesive or the pressure-sensitive adhesive solution to disperse air bubbles in advance, and the gas is applied onto the base material. (Japanese Patent Publication No. 60-3350).

Generally, the method (2) above is carried out because it is inexpensive, but the size of the bubbles varies with the passage of time, and the dispersed state of the bubbles becomes uneven. There is. Therefore, it is desirable that the operation of dispersing the bubbles in the pressure-sensitive adhesive solution is performed in a transportation pipe close to the coating machine in an amount required according to the amount used.

Japanese Patent Publication No. 60-3350 discloses a hot-melt adhesive, which is not related to a pressure-sensitive adhesive solution, but is blown with gas during transportation by piping.
A method of dispersing with a gear pump has been proposed. However, this method is too large in terms of equipment, and a simpler adhesive tape manufacturing equipment has been required.

The present invention has been made to solve the above problems and to achieve the above objects. An adhesive solution is supplied from a storage tank to a coating machine and is applied to a substrate. A gear pump is used as a means for supplying the pressure-sensitive adhesive solution in the step of manufacturing the pressure-sensitive adhesive tape by applying the pressure-sensitive adhesive solution and then heating and drying, and the end clearance of the gear pump is set to 0.3 mm to 0.8 mm. It is characterized by. Here, the end clearance means a gap between the side surface of the rotor of the gear pump and the casing.

In the method of manufacturing the adhesive tape of the present invention,
When supplying the adhesive solution from the storage tank to the coating machine with a gear pump,
Since there is a gap (end clearance) between the casing of the gear pump and the side surface of the rotor, when the rotor starts rotating, outside air is sucked into the inflow side of the gear pump through the bearing and end clearance of the rotor. . The sucked air becomes air bubbles and is carried to the discharge side by the gear of the rotor together with the adhesive solution. At that time, the air bubbles are subdivided and dispersed by the biting of the gears of the two rotors, and are supplied to the coating machine from the discharge port.

If the end clearance is too small, the amount of air taken in will be small, and it will not be possible to create sufficient air bubbles. On the other hand, if this gap is too large,
The pressure-sensitive adhesive solution may flow back from the discharge side to the inflow side, and the discharge amount may be reduced.

EXAMPLES Next, the method for producing the pressure-sensitive adhesive tape of the present invention will be described by way of examples. The adhesive used in this example was an acrylic resin adhesive, which was dissolved in a mixed solvent of ethyl acetate and toluene and had a viscosity at room temperature of 8,000 cps.
It is adjusted to ~ 12,000 cps. A longitudinal sectional view of the used gear pump is shown in FIG. 1, and its AA sectional view is shown in FIG. 1 indicates the outer rotor and 2 indicates the inner rotor. 3 is a drive shaft of the rotor 1, 4 is a shaft of the rotor 2, 5 is a casing of the pump body, 6 is a discharge port, 7
Is an inlet, and 8 is an end clearance.

When the pump starts to operate, the drive shaft 3 rotates the rotor 1 in the direction of the arrow, and at the same time the rotor 2 also rotates, sucking the adhesive solution from the inflow port 7 and pumping it to the discharge port 6. At that time, a part of the outside air is sucked into the inflow side through the gap between the rotor shaft 4 and the casing 5 and the end clearance 8 to generate bubbles. The adhesive solution containing the bubbles is conveyed to the discharge side by the gear of the rotor, but is compressed by the biting of the gear of the rotor,
The contained bubbles are subdivided and dispersed. When the end clearance was 0.5 mm and the number of rotations of the rotor 1 was set to 110 rpm, the discharge pressure was about 7 kg / cm 2 .

As a result, the diameter of the bubbles contained in the pressure-sensitive adhesive solution applied to the substrate by the roll coater is 5 μm to 15 μm.
The diameter of bubbles formed in the pressure-sensitive adhesive layer of the pressure-sensitive adhesive tape obtained by heating and drying this was 20 μ to 70 μ.

As described above, in order to produce a pressure-sensitive adhesive tape in which bubbles are dispersed in the pressure-sensitive adhesive layer, conventionally, since the bubbles were dispersed in a storage tank, a pressure-sensitive adhesive solution having a relatively low viscosity was used. When used, there was a large variation in the size of the bubbles, and they were dispersed non-uniformly, but in the manufacturing method of the present invention, since the bubbles are generated in the pipe supplied to the coating machine, the size of the bubbles is It is now possible to feed the pressure-sensitive adhesive solution, which has a small variation and is uniformly dispersed, to the coating machine at the required time and in the required amount.
